Curtis N. Sessler is a scholar working on Critical Care and Intensive Care Medicine,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and Anesthesiology and Pain Medicine. According to data from OpenAlex, Curtis N. Sessler has authored 115 papers receiving a total of 9.0k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 57 papers in Critical Care and Intensive Care Medicine, 39 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and 27 papers in Anesthesiology and Pain Medicine. Recurrent topics in Curtis N. Sessler's work include Intensive Care Unit Cognitive Disorders (44 papers), Respiratory Support and Mechanisms (31 papers) and Anesthesia and Sedative Agents (21 papers). Curtis N. Sessler is often cited by papers focused on Intensive Care Unit Cognitive Disorders (44 papers), Respiratory Support and Mechanisms (31 papers) and Anesthesia and Sedative Agents (21 papers). Curtis N. Sessler collaborates with scholars based in United States, Australia and United Kingdom. Curtis N. Sessler's co-authors include Mary Jo Grap, R. K. Elswick, Gretchen M. Brophy, Pamela V. O’Neal, Eljim P. Tesoro, Ruth Kleinpell, Marc Moss, Vicki S. Good, David Gozal and Cindy L. Munro and has published in prestigious journals such as JAMA, American Journal of Respiratory and Critical Care Medicine and Journal of Applied Physiology.
